Contrats intelligents FHE de Zama garantissent la confidentialité sur la blockchain
Chapô : La technologie du chiffrement entièrement homomorphe (FHE) révolutionne les contrats intelligents en préservant la confidentialité des données sur la blockchain. Grâce à la bibliothèque de Zama, les développeurs peuvent créer des applications décentralisées sécurisées et privées. Cet article explore l'importance du FHE, son fonctionnement et comment il répond aux défis de confidentialité.
Les enjeux de la décentralisation et de la transparence
La technologie blockchain est louée pour sa capacité à garantir une décentralisation et une visibilité totale sur toutes les transactions. Cependant, cette transparence pose également un problème majeur : elle expose souvent des informations sensibles liées aux utilisateurs. Les contrats intelligents, qui sont des programmes s'exécutant automatiquement sur la blockchain, offrent donc à la fois des avantages indéniables mais aussi le risque d'une exposition non désirée.
Le chiffrement entièrement homomorphe (FHE) représente une solution innovante en permettant l'exécution de ces contrats sans révéler les données sensibles qu'ils manipulent. La bibliothèque Zama joue un rôle clé dans cette avancée technologique, fournissant des outils adaptés pour intégrer le FHE dans le développement d'applications privées.
Comprendre le chiffrement entièrement homomorphe (FHE)
Le chiffrement entièrement homomorphe est une méthode avancée qui permet d’effectuer des calculs sur des données cryptées comme si elles étaient en texte clair. Cela signifie que les informations restent complètement cachées pendant leur traitement tout en garantissant leur exactitude lors du décryptage ultérieur.
Contrairement aux méthodes classiques où il faut exposer les données en texte clair pour effectuer des opérations, le FHE élimine ce risque, rendant ainsi son utilisation pertinente dans divers domaines tels que la finance, la santé ou encore la blockchain. Ce mécanisme offre ainsi une protection solide même dans des environnements jugés peu fiables.
L'importance cruciale de la confidentialité dans les contrats intelligents
La question de la confidentialité financière est essentielle ; chaque détail transactionnel doit rester secret afin d’éviter toute manipulation ou exploitation malveillante. De même, pour ce qui concerne les secteurs liés à la santé et à l’identité personnelle, l’exposition d’informations sensibles telles que les dossiers médicaux serait inacceptable.
Pour favoriser l’adoption par les entreprises, ces dernières doivent pouvoir protéger leurs secrets commerciaux contre tout risque d’espionnage industriel ou de divulgation non autorisée. Par ailleurs, avec strictes exigences comme celles imposées par le RGPD pour assurer une protection adéquate des données personnelles, maintenir cette confidentialité devient impératif.
Sans solutions adaptées comme celle offerte par le FHE via Zama, plusieurs secteurs resteraient réticents à utiliser pleinement les potentialités offertes par la blockchain.
Pourquoi intégrer le FHE dans vos contrats intelligents ?
La transparence inhérente aux contrats intelligents peut renforcer considérablement la confiance, mais elle peut également mener au partage involontaire de données privées cruciales. Dans divers flux opérationnels tels que ceux observés en finance ou en santé, cette exposition peut freiner l’adoption massive nécessaire au succès commercial.
L'intégration du chiffrement totalement homomorphe permettrait alors un traitement sécurisé de ces données sans qu'elles ne soient révélées durant leurs manipulations. En utilisant Zama comme bibliothèque intégrative au sein de technologies blockchain existantes, on pourrait voir émerger un nouveau standard avec des contrats privés où toutes entrées et sorties demeurent chiffrées.
Zama propose une approche unique avec ses bibliothèques
Zama se positionne comme un acteur innovant avec ses bibliothèques destinées aux éditeurs logiciels cherchant à mettre en œuvre efficacement le FHE :
TFHE-rs : Cette implémentation Rust optimise vitesse et convivialité pour faciliter sa mise en œuvre.
Béton : Un ensemble complet d’outils et frameworks dédiés permettant aux développeurs d’intégrer facilement le FHE au sein de leurs applications.
Intégration spécifique : Zama engage activement sa recherche vers l’application directe du FHE avec un focus particulier sur ses interactions avec blockchain afin d’assurer sécurité et conformité tout au long du processus.
Ce qui distingue Zama réside principalement dans son souci constant envers ses utilisateurs : plutôt que se perdre dans théories abstraites complexes, elle fournit API utilisables accompagnées métriques facilitant intégrations pratiques pour développeurs travaillant autour blockchains variés.
Mise en œuvre pratique grâce à Zama
Pour débuter :
Cryptage initial : Les utilisateurs appliquent directement modèles proposés par Zama afin de chiffrer leurs propres données avant soumission auprès contrat intelligent ;
Calcul sécurisé : Le contrat exécute logiques basées sur ces mêmes données cryptées sans jamais devoir réaliser décryptages intermédiaires ;
Mise à jour sécurisée : Tous états relatifs au contrat (soldes actuels , offres soumises etc.) demeurent sous forme chiffrée jusqu’à validation finale ;
Données finales sécurisées : Après exécution effective du contrat smart , résultats renvoyés restent sous format crypté jusqu’à intervention utilisateur localement réalisé .
Illustration concrète : enchères privées
Prenons exemple classique traditionnel où chaque participant voit directement offres concurrentielles ; ici notons que cela favorise potentielle manipulation .
Dans cadre enchères utilisant structure FHE imaginons alors situation où propositions stockent uniquement version chiffrée auprès plateforme ;
Ainsi contrat intelligent capable dès lors déterminer meilleure offre sans avoir accès direct variantes claires ; seuls gagnants ainsi prix final révélés après clôture phase enchérissement .
Difficultés rencontrées lors mise-en-place
Des défis persistent malgré innovations apportées :
- Surcharge computationnelle : Le système impliquant usage lourd calcule comparativement opérations standards.
- Couts additionnels :L’exécution chaînes demandes ressources financières nettement supérieures.
- Aptitudes requises chez développeurs:Nouveaux paradigmes nécessaires exigent adaptation complète conception initiale.
- Maturité outillage:ZAMA progresse rapidement cependant écosystèmes nécessitent soutien accru continu.
Bénéfices liés aux solutions contractuelles proposées par ZAMA
Voici quelques atouts majeurs offerts:
Confidentialité intrinsèque :Aucune donnée claire n’est exposée durant cycle opérationnel complet .
Confiance minimale requise :Aucun besoin faire appel intermédiaires garder secret intact .
Sécurité adaptable :Cela permet interactions tout gardant encryptions intactes .
Anticipation future :Tous besoins régulateurs entreprises respectivement satisfaits via modèles conçus .
Aperçu futur prometteur
Les initiatives lancées par zamas annoncent véritablement avènement blockchains axé préservation confidentielle; plus performances augmentent davantage sophistication outils développements disponibles accessibles futurs diplômés;
- < li > Finances décentralisées incluant services prêts échanges privés; < li > Systèmes sanitaires intégrants protections concernant patients; < li > Élections assurant anonymat véracité maintenue; < li > Blockchains professionnelles sauvegardent workflows critiques sensibilité.;< / ul >
Avec tous progrès réalisés actuellement potentiels transformateurs impact sectoriel demeure immense tant qu’accompagnement approprié reste mis place !
